Enforcement officer of Islington council falsely accused me of spitting and sent FPN by AnyMess4074 in LegalAdviceUK

[–]thetryingintrovert 5 points6 points  (0 children)

Paying an FPN “under duress” is legally meaningless. If OP pays it, then they are accepting the FPN (though not admitting guilt) and the matter is concluded.

An SAR won’t get them the footage, if the council proceeds with a prosecution and pleads not guilty then it will be disclosed to them if it exists.

OP being of good character is also irrelevant for trial purposes.

I’d say it is worth OP or their solicitor writing to the council to see if they will review the matter with a view to discontinue. It might not go anywhere but there’s no harm in trying.
